--- id: bad87fee1348bd9aedc08826 title: Individuare elementi per classe usando jQuery challengeType: 6 forumTopicId: 18316 required: - link: 'https://cdnjs.cloudflare.com/ajax/libs/animate.css/3.2.0/animate.css' dashedName: target-elements-by-class-using-jquery --- # --description-- Vedi come abbiamo fatto rimbalzare tutti gli elementi del tuo `button`? Li abbiamo selezionati con `$("button")`, poi abbiamo aggiunto alcune classi CSS con `.addClass("animated bounce");`. Hai appena usato la funzione `.addClass()` di jQuery, che ti permette di aggiungere classi agli elementi. Innanzitutto, individuiamo gli elementi `div` con la classe `well` utilizzando il selettore `$(".well")`. Nota che, proprio come con le dichiarazioni CSS, devi digitare un `.` prima del nome della classe. Quindi usa la funzione `.addClass()` di jQuery per aggiungere le classi `animated` e `shake`. Ad esempio, potresti scuotere tutti gli elementi di classe `text-primary` aggiungendo quanto segue alla tua `document ready function`: ```js $(".text-primary").addClass("animated shake"); ``` # --hints-- Dovresti usare la funzione jQuery `addClass()` per dare le classi `animated` e `shake` a tutti i tuoi elementi di classe `well`. ```js assert($('.well').hasClass('animated') && $('.well').hasClass('shake')); ``` Dovresti usare solo jQuery per aggiungere queste classi all'elemento. ```js assert(!code.match(/class\.\*animated/g)); ``` # --seed-- ## --seed-contents-- ```html

jQuery Playground

#left-well

#right-well

``` # --solutions-- ```html

jQuery Playground

#left-well

#right-well

```